Why Are SBI Employees Striking?
Understanding the reasons behind the SBI employees striking requires a closer look at the issues they're trying to address. Typically, bank strikes stem from a combination of factors, reflecting the concerns and demands of the employees. Here’s a breakdown of some common reasons:
- Wage Revisions: One of the most frequent triggers for bank strikes is the demand for wage revisions. Bank employees, like workers in any other sector, seek periodic adjustments to their salaries to keep up with inflation and the rising cost of living. Unions negotiate with bank management to secure fair wage hikes that reflect the employees' contributions and skills. If the negotiations fail to produce a satisfactory outcome, employees might resort to striking to push for their demands.
- Better Working Conditions: Beyond just wages, the conditions in which bank employees work play a significant role in their overall job satisfaction and well-being. Overcrowded branches, long working hours, inadequate staffing, and lack of basic amenities can all contribute to a stressful work environment. Employees may strike to demand improvements in these conditions, seeking a more supportive and conducive atmosphere that allows them to perform their duties effectively.
- Pension Benefits: Pension benefits are a critical aspect of financial security for bank employees after retirement. Unions often advocate for improved pension schemes, ensuring that retirees receive adequate financial support to maintain a decent standard of living. Demands may include increasing the pension amount, extending coverage to more employees, or addressing anomalies in existing pension plans. Strikes can be a means to pressure the management to address these pension-related concerns.
- Job Security: In an era of increasing automation and technological advancements, job security is a growing concern for bank employees. The introduction of new technologies and the restructuring of banking operations can lead to fears of job losses or displacement. Unions may strike to protect the interests of their members, seeking assurances of job security and measures to mitigate the impact of technological changes on employment.
- Other Grievances: Besides these primary concerns, various other grievances can also fuel bank strikes. These might include issues related to promotions, transfers, disciplinary actions, or welfare measures. Employees may feel that their grievances are not being adequately addressed through normal channels, leading them to take collective action in the form of a strike. Unions act as the voice of the employees, representing their concerns and negotiating with the management to find amicable solutions.
It's worth noting that the specific reasons for an SBI bank strike can vary depending on the context and the prevailing issues at the time. Understanding these reasons is essential to appreciating the employees' perspective and the motivations behind their collective action.
Impact of the Strike on the General Public
The impact of an SBI bank strike on the general public can be quite significant, affecting various aspects of daily life and financial transactions. When bank employees go on strike, it inevitably leads to disruptions in banking services, causing inconvenience and challenges for customers. Here's a closer look at the potential impacts:
- Disruption of Banking Services: The most immediate and noticeable impact of a bank strike is the disruption of banking services. Bank branches may be closed or operate with limited staff, leading to long queues and delays in transactions. Customers may find it difficult to deposit or withdraw money, transfer funds, or access other essential banking services. This disruption can be particularly problematic for individuals who rely on regular branch visits for their banking needs.
- ATM Services Affected: ATM services can also be affected during a bank strike. As bank branches close or operate with reduced staff, the replenishment of cash in ATMs may be delayed. This can lead to ATMs running out of cash more quickly than usual, leaving customers stranded without access to funds. The inconvenience of ATMs not functioning properly can be particularly acute in areas where access to bank branches is limited.
- Delays in Transactions: A bank strike can cause delays in various types of transactions, including cheque clearances, online transfers, and loan processing. Businesses may face difficulties in making payments to suppliers or receiving payments from customers, disrupting their cash flow. Individuals may experience delays in receiving salaries, pensions, or other payments, affecting their ability to meet their financial obligations.
- Inconvenience to Customers: Overall, a bank strike causes significant inconvenience to customers, who may have to spend more time and effort to complete their banking transactions. The uncertainty and disruption can be frustrating, especially for those who have urgent financial needs. Customers may have to adjust their plans and make alternative arrangements to cope with the situation.
- Economic Impact: Beyond the immediate inconvenience to individuals, a prolonged bank strike can also have broader economic implications. Disruptions in banking services can affect business activity, trade, and investment. The overall economic impact depends on the duration and scale of the strike, as well as the extent to which alternative banking channels are available to mitigate the disruptions.
To minimize the impact of a bank strike, it's advisable to stay informed about the situation and plan ahead. Consider using alternative banking channels such as online banking, mobile banking, or ATMs to conduct transactions. Keep sufficient cash on hand to cover your immediate needs, and be prepared for potential delays in banking services. By taking these precautions, you can reduce the inconvenience and disruption caused by the strike.
